I'll use our current #1, You've Really Got A Hold On Me, as an example.

It was voted in with 23 points in week 11.

Week 12: It carried those 23 points in, and received +8 that week = 31.

Week 13: Only got +4 = 35.

Week 14: Got +16 = 51. Entered Top Ten @ #6.

Week 15: Got +10 = 61. Went to #3.

Week 16: Got +12 = 73. Reached #1.

This week: Got +4 = 77. Still #1 ( no secret I would think !).

In contrast, our #40 song this week got in with 17 votes.

So there's usually a 50/60 points spread from first to last.

.................................................

I also started a 'disinterest' penalty. If a song receives no votes in a week (for or against) it loses 2 votes; Travelin' Man this week.

And, because we are so loath to vote our 'old favorites' out, at Cyberjudge's suggestion I've adopted a 'time' penalty. Those songs that have been in over 10 weeks lose 1/2 point for each week above 10.

e.g. All I Have To Do Is Dream had been in for 16 weeks, so it automatically lost 3 points this week (1/2 X 6).

Welcome back to another fact-filled edition of Golden Oldies Top 40. I’m your host DJ Ceejay, and we’ve got a lot of ground to cover, so let’s get started.

There are 4 drop-outs from our countdown this week:

Mr. Sandman by the Chordettes, which had peaked at #36,

Hit the Road Jack by Ray Charles, which topped off at #20,

Surfin USA by the Beach Boys, which got as high as #6, and

Crazy by Patsy Cline which made it all the way to the runner-up spot at #2.

Of the 4 songs entering the chart this week, 3 are by artists with multiple songs in this week’s countdown:

The 4 Seasons enter at #40 with Candy Girl, joining Sherry, which hangs on this week at #28. Candy Girl is the 3rd entry on the chart for the 4 Seasons, who debuted on the very first chart with Big Girls Don’t Cry.

One notch ahead of them are the Drifters, who enter at #39 with Save the Last Dance for Me. The Drifters also celebrate their 15th week in the countdown for Up on the Roof, this week at #32. And lead singer Ben E. King is also still in the countdown, with his solo hit Stand by Me at #24.

The Johnny Otis Show makes its 1st chart appearance at #36 with Willie and the Hand Jive.

And the highest debut of the week at #19 is You Don’t Own Me by Lesley Gore, whom we’ll see later in the countdown with It’s My Party.

And I can already hear you all saying, what other artists have had multiple songs in the countdown in a single week. Well, I’m glad you asked. There are 7 other artists that have had multiple songs, making a total of 10 including this week’s debuts.

Pat Boone had 2 songs on the initial GO-40 chart, with Love Letters in the Sand and April Love.

Roy Orbison has 2 songs which have been together on the chart for 13 weeks and are still on the current chart: Crying, now at #12 and Only the Lonely at #22.

Chuck Berry also has 2 songs on this week’s chart as well, Johnny B. Goode at #21 and Maybelline just ahead at #20.

And the Miracles have 2 songs in the chart as well: Shop Around at #7 and last week’s #1, You’ve Really Got a Hold on Me.

2 more artists have had 3 songs on the chart at once, and 1 of those is still there:

The Everly Brothers have 3 songs on this week’s chart: All I Have to Do Is Dream at #17, Cathy’s Clown at #30 and Wake Up Little Susie at #35.

Ray Charles also had 3 songs on the chart back in week #10 with I Can’t Stop Loving You, Georgia on My Mind and Hit the Road Jack. Only 1 of these songs is still in the countdown, but in its 12th week, Georgia on My Mind climbs to its highest position yet at #5.

And of course, the artist with the most songs on the chart at once is Elvis Presley, who occupied ¼ of the chart with 10 songs in each of the 1st 2 charts:

Don’t Be Cruel, Hound Dog, All Shook Up, Hearbreak Hotel, Jailhouse Rock, Let me Be Your Teddy Bear, Are You Lonesome Tonight, Love Me Tender, It’s Now or Never, and Don’t (which was replaced in week #2 by Can’t Help Falling in Love).

The biggest movers in the countdown this week are:

Come Go with Me, up 11 slots from #40 to #29,

Dream Lover, also gaining 11 from #22 to #11, and

the biggest mover this week is I Walk the Line, which jumps 12 spots from #16 to #4, and is our only new song in the top 10 this week.

Holding at #3 is a former #1, Love Potion #9 by the Clovers, while

Sneaking up 2 places, from #4 to #2 is Lesley Gore with It’s My Party.

That means that holding again at #1 this week is:

:drummer:

You’ve Really Got a Hold on Me, by the Miracles.
